Understanding Anxiety: Recognizing Signs and Symptoms
Anxiety is a natural response to stress, but when it becomes persistent and overwhelming, it can significantly impact daily life. Recognizing the signs and symptoms is the first step towards managing anxiety effectively. Common physical indicators include rapid heartbeat, shortness of breath, muscle tension, and sleep disturbances. Emotionally, individuals may experience excessive worry, fear, or restlessness.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T): A Popular Anxiety Management Approach
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) is a widely recognized and effective approach to managing anxiety disorders, offered by many health service providers, including Kaiser Permanente in Boulder. This therapeutic method focuses on identifying and changing negative thought patterns and behaviors that contribute to anxious feelings. CBT helps individuals understand how their thoughts influence their emotions and subsequent actions, offering practical tools for emotional regulation.
Through structured sessions with a trained therapist, patients learn to challenge distorted thinking and replace it with more realistic and positive thoughts. This process empowers them to manage their anxiety symptoms effectively. Additional Techniques: Mindfulness, Relaxation, and Lifestyle Changes for Better Mental Well-being
Anxiety management extends beyond traditional therapy and medication. Incorporating mindfulness practices, deep relaxation techniques, and lifestyle adjustments can significantly contribute to improved mental well-being. Mindfulness encourages staying present and focusing on the here and now without judgment. This approach helps individuals detach from anxious thoughts and reduces reactivity to stressors. Relaxation techniques such as deep breathing exercises and progressive muscle relaxation can activate the body’s natural calming response, counteracting the physical symptoms of anxiety. Additionally, lifestyle changes, like regular exercise, adequate sleep, and a balanced diet, play a crucial role in managing anxiety, promoting overall mental health, and fostering resilience.
